Because KrakenFiles doesn't have a search bar, users rely on external methods. The most common technique uses advanced search operators in major search engines like Google or Bing. krakenfiles search
Example: site:krakenfiles.com "tutorial" Google may index some public KrakenFiles links if they’ve been shared publicly elsewhere (forums, Reddit, Telegram).
